AOPP引发MODS患者血清MMP-9和炎症递质的变化及其临床意义 被引量:3

The Change and Clinical Significances of Serum MMP-9 and Inflammatory Factor in Patients of Acute Organophosphorus Pesticide Poisoning with Multiple Organ Dysfunction Syndrome

摘要 目的观察急性有机磷农药中毒(AOPP)致多器官功能障碍综合征(MODS)患者血清肿瘤坏死因子-α(TNF-α)、白细胞介素-6(IL-6)、白细胞介素-10(IL-10)及基质金属蛋白酶-9(MMP-9)的动态变化及其关系,探讨 AOPP 引发 MODS 的机制。方法采用酶联免疫吸附试验双抗体夹心法检测42例 AOPP 伴 MODS 患者血清中 TNF-α、IL-6、IL-10及 MMP-9的水平,与正常对照组进行比较,并采用 Pearson 相关分析方法分析 MMP-9与 TNF—α、IL-6、IL-10的相关关系。结果 AOPP 患者血清TNF-α、IL-6、IL-10含量均升高,与正常对照组相比差异非常显著。血清 MMP-9水平与 TNF-α、IL-6、IL-10的水平呈明显的正相关关系。结论 AOPP 可导致炎症递质失调。MMP-9通过调控炎症递质参与了全身炎症反应综合征(SIRS)向 MODS 的发生发展过程。 Objective To investigate the dynamic variations and relationship of tumor necrosis factor-α(TNF-α), interleukin-6 (IL-6), interleukin-10( IL-10 ) and matrix metalloproteinase-9 (MMP-9) in serum of patients of acute organophosphorus pesticide poisoning (AOPP)with multiple organs dysfunction syndrome(MODS) and discussed the mechanism of MODS. Methods 42 patients with AOPP and MODS were enrolled in this study. TNF-α, IL-6, IL-10 and MMP-9 in their serum were detected with double antibody Sandwich-Enzyme linked with immunosorbent assay(DAS-ELISA) and compared with control group. The relations of TNF-α,IL-6,IL-10 and MMP-9 were analyzed with person correlation analysis. Results The contents of TNF-α, IL-6, IL-10 and MMP-9 elevated obviously in the serum of patients with AOPP,there was significant difference between patients with AOPP and normal control( P 〈 0.01 ). The level of MMP-9 had positive correlation with TNF-α, IL-6,IL-10. Conclusion AOPP may induce the disturbance of the inflammatory factor,and MMP-9 plays an important role in the development from SIRS to MODS in AOPP patients by regulating the inflammatory factors.
